About L. N. Khanov

L. N. Khanov is a scholar working on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Condensed Matter Physics and Materials Chemistry, having authored 24 papers that have together received 336 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Magnetic and transport properties of perovskites and related materials (18 papers), Shape Memory Alloy Transformations (17 papers) and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(311 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(91 citations) and Materials Chemistry (248 citations). L. N. Khanov has collaborated with scholars based in Russia, Vietnam and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include A. M. Aliev, A. B. Batdalov, В. Г. Шавров, А. В. Маширов, Sergey Taskaev, V. V. Koledov, A. G. Gamzatov, А. П. Каманцев, V. D. Buchelnikov and В. В. Коледов.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Physics Letters, Journal of Applied Physics and Journal of Physics D Applied Physics.
